Fashion has always been inspired by cultures from around the world and this Fashionista's style is no different! Designers are always pulling styles from around the world and adding their own spin. A few weeks ago at New York Fashion Week, Ralph Lauren presented his spring 2013 ready-to-wear collection that was inspired by traditional Spanish costume from matadors and women. He captured the true essence of how the Spaniards dressed; however, each garment had its own sexy flare and modern touch.
